No, because the office of the president didn't exist yet. When Adams was a child, Massachusetts was still a British colony. He wanted to be a lawyer.

President Gerald R. Ford (1974-1977) did not want to be President of the US. His aspiration was to be Speaker of the US House of Representatives.
